How they compare

British Virgin Islands currently reports 3.58 units per square kilometre against 3.44 units per square kilometre in Tonga, a difference of 0.14 units per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1975 it was Tonga ahead.

British Virgin Islands ranks 73rd and Tonga ranks 75th of 200 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, British Virgin Islands averaged higher in 4 and Tonga in 1.
